黑客什么编程水平好用啊

不及物动词 其他 15

回复

共2条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    黑客的编程水平在很大程度上决定了他们在攻击和防御方面的能力。一个好的黑客应该具备以下几个方面的编程水平:

    1. 编程语言掌握广泛:黑客应该熟练掌握多种编程语言,如Python、C++、Java等。不同的编程语言在不同应用场景下有着不同的优势,掌握多种编程语言可以更好地应对不同的情况。

    2. 深入了解底层原理:黑客应该对计算机底层的原理有深入的了解,包括操作系统、网络协议、数据库等。只有对底层原理有着透彻的理解,才能更好地利用和绕过系统的漏洞。

    3. 熟悉常见漏洞和攻击技术:黑客应该对常见的漏洞和攻击技术有深入的了解,如SQL注入、XSS跨站脚本攻击、CSRF跨站请求伪造等。只有熟悉这些漏洞和攻击技术,才能更好地进行攻击和防御。

    4. 掌握逆向工程技术:黑客应该掌握逆向工程技术,可以通过反汇编和调试等手段分析和修改程序的执行过程。逆向工程对于理解程序的内部机制和查找漏洞非常重要。

    5. 具备网络安全知识:黑客应该具备一定的网络安全知识,包括网络拓扑、防火墙配置、入侵检测等。只有了解网络安全的基本原理,才能更好地进行攻击和防御。

    不同的黑客在编程水平上可能有所侧重,有些黑客更擅长开发攻击工具和利用漏洞进行攻击,而有些黑客更擅长分析和修复漏洞来提高系统的安全性。无论哪种类型的黑客,都需要具备扎实的编程基础和深入的技术理解。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    黑客是指具有高超计算机技术,能够破解密码和入侵计算机系统,以及进行网络攻击和安全防护的专业人士。他们的编程水平在黑客界被视为重要的技能之一。以下是几个衡量黑客编程水平好用的标准:

    1. 编程语言掌握:黑客通常需要掌握多种编程语言,以便根据不同的攻击和防御场景进行编程。常用的编程语言包括Python、C、C++、Java和Ruby等。熟练掌握这些编程语言是衡量黑客编程水平的重要指标。

    2. 网络安全知识:黑客需要了解网络安全的相关知识,包括网络协议、网络拓扑结构、漏洞分析和渗透测试等。了解这些知识可以帮助黑客更好地理解和利用系统漏洞,进行攻击和防御。

    3. 数据结构与算法:黑客编程中需要处理大量的数据和复杂的算法问题。熟练掌握各种数据结构和算法可以提高编程效率和解决问题的能力。

    4. 漏洞挖掘:黑客需要具备漏洞挖掘的能力,即通过分析代码和系统,找出其中的安全漏洞。这涉及到对系统的深入理解和对常见漏洞类型的熟悉。

    5. 创新能力:好用的黑客编程水平还需要有创新能力,能够想出新颖的攻击方式和防御方法。创新能力是区分普通程序员和优秀黑客的一项关键技能。

    需要注意的是,在进行黑客攻击时是非法且道德问题。以上讨论的编程水平是指在合法和道德的前提下,黑客对网络安全进行攻防的技能水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部